The Evolution of Elvis's Music in His Later Years

As Elvis Presley reached the later stages of his career, his music began to reflect personal growth and evolving tastes. While his early hits showcased youthful exuberance, his later songs often encapsulated deeper themes of love, nostalgia, and reflection.
What characterized the sound of older Elvis Presley?
In his older years, Elvis incorporated a mix of gospel, country, and folk into his rock and roll roots. This blend contributed to a richer, more textured sound that showcased his vocal prowess.

The Impact of Older Elvis Presley on Pop Culture

Elvis's influence transcended music; it permeated fashion, film, and even social movements. In his older years, he became a cultural icon who inspired generations, shaping the music landscape and linking various musical genres.
What was Elvis's role in shaping popular culture during his later years?
During the 1970s, older Elvis's lavish lifestyle and unique style made headlines, influencing everything from fashion to film. His presence on stage was mesmerizing, and his passion resonated with fans.
Example: Influence on Fashion
A case study by Rolling Stone highlights how Elvis's jumpsuits became iconic fashion statements, setting trends that persist today.
